Форум Flasher.ru
Ближайшие курсы в Школе RealTime
Список интенсивных курсов: [см.]  
  
Специальные предложения: [см.]  
  
 
Блоги Правила Справка Пользователи Календарь Сообщения за день
 

Вернуться   Форум Flasher.ru > Flash > Flex

Версия для печати  Отправить по электронной почте    « Предыдущая тема | Следующая тема »  
Опции темы Опции просмотра
 
Создать новую тему Ответ
Старый 15.04.2008, 23:07
candysays вне форума Посмотреть профиль Отправить личное сообщение для candysays Найти все сообщения от candysays
  № 1  
Ответить с цитированием
candysays

Регистрация: Apr 2008
Сообщений: 5
Question ввод данных через DataGrid

собственно, вопрос в том, как организовать ввод некоторого количества данных(только числа) в ячейки DataGrid. одного
Код:
editable="true"
не хватает. хотелось бы знать, насколько вообще это оправдано с точки зрения удобства дальнейшей обработки по отношению к куче TextInput'ов.
короче, подскажите, пожалуйста, как сделать так, чтобы можно было ткнуть по ячейке и написать туда, что нужно

Старый 16.04.2008, 01:14
baron27 вне форума Посмотреть профиль Отправить личное сообщение для baron27 Посетить домашнюю страницу baron27 Найти все сообщения от baron27
  № 2  
Ответить с цитированием
baron27
Контрибьютор базы знаний по Флекс
 
Аватар для baron27

Регистрация: Aug 2005
Сообщений: 690
В хелпе есть примеры. Поищи по itemEditor.
__________________
Flex 2 и Co

Старый 18.04.2008, 04:37
candysays вне форума Посмотреть профиль Отправить личное сообщение для candysays Найти все сообщения от candysays
  № 3  
Ответить с цитированием
candysays

Регистрация: Apr 2008
Сообщений: 5
с этим разобрался. теперь проблема с AdvancedDataGrid
Код:
...
<mx:groupedColumns>
       <mx:AdvancedDataGridColumn dataField="num"/>
       <mx:AdvancedDataGridColumnGroup dataField="dynamicAirHead">
              <mx:AdvancedDataGridColumn dataField="x" />
              <mx:AdvancedDataGridColumn dataField="deltaL"/>
              <mx:AdvancedDataGridColumn dataField="deltaH"/>
       </mx:AdvancedDataGridColumnGroup>
...
в этом примере при редактировании ячеек столбца num введенное значение сохраняется, а в сгруппированных столбцах - нет. почему?

сам массив вот (т.е. только первая строка):
Код:
private var expRawData:ArrayCollection = new ArrayCollection([
{num:				"1", 
dynamicAirHead: 		{x:"0", deltaL:"0", deltaH:"0"}, 
staticPressureFallInBeam: 	{x1:"0", deltaL1:"0", deltaP:"0"},
airTemperature: 			{tAirDash:"0", tAirDoubleDash:"0"}, 
powerInput: 			{w:"0"},
surfaceTemperature: 		{eDash:"0", tWallDash:"0", eDoubleDash:"0", tWallDoubleDash:"0"} 
 }])
Всего-то надо забить числа и записать обратно в массив. совсем запутался


Последний раз редактировалось candysays; 18.04.2008 в 14:34.
Создать новую тему Ответ Часовой пояс GMT +4, время: 07:50.
Быстрый переход
  « Предыдущая тема | Следующая тема »  

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.


 


Часовой пояс GMT +4, время: 07:50.


Copyright © 1999-2008 Flasher.ru. All rights reserved.
Работает на vBulletin®. Copyright ©2000 - 2026, Jelsoft Enterprises Ltd. Перевод: zCarot
Администрация сайта не несёт ответственности за любую предоставленную посетителями информацию. Подробнее см. Правила.